Vue是一個流行的JavaScript框架,它可以輕松地將HTML頁面和JavaScript代碼結合在一起。Vue可以在HTML頁面中編寫代碼,其中包含了許多不同類型的元素。其中包括標準的HTML標記(如<div>和<span>),以及Vue特有的元素,如<template>和<component>。
Vue.component('todo-item', { props: ['todo'], template: '<li>{{ todo.text }}</li>' })
在Vue的HTML元素中,我們可以使用屬性來定義不同的選項和配置項。例如,我們可以使用v-bind指令來將表達式綁定到元素的屬性上:
<div v-bind:class="{ active: isActive }"></div>
Vue還支持使用聲明式渲染來編寫HTML代碼。我們可以使用v-for指令來遍歷數組,并使用v-if指令對不同的條件進行分支。下面是一個示例:
<div v-for="(item, index) in items" v-if="item.isActive"> {{ index }}: {{ item.title }} </div>
總之,Vue的HTML包含了許多不同類型的元素和指令,這些元素和指令可以將頁面的結構和樣式與數據和業務邏輯聯系在一起,使得我們可以更加有效地開發和維護Web應用程序。